Las Vegas "An Irishman in Vegas Redo" (2015) 2:16 (Ireland)

It's gotten to the point where a lot of creatives go to youtube first for their "ideas." As in "Idea 1: Let's use (insert youtube influencer with built in audience here) to star in our spot. Often the person has zero to do with the product being advertised. Thankfully this film gets it right from concept to reward to unintended "influencer."
Poor Griffin decided to document his entire Vegas trip using a GoPro. Unfortunately he had it on selfie-mode. His Youtube video garnered 7 million hits at his derpy move. So the good people at the Las Vegas Convention and Visitors Authority saw his video (and saw how much he loved Vegas) they gave him a second chance to check out the place and document it in a proper way. Only this time it was in crazy style, culminating in a nighttime Maverick Helicopter tour of the Strip.

Even more interesting is that Griffin works in the tourist industry himself as a bus driver for Keith Bruen Coaches back in Ireland.

See kids, sometimes being derpy pays off.

Client: The Las Vegas Convention and Visitors Authority
